Answer:

Very Unhealthy

Explanation:

"Very Unhealthy" AQI is 201 to 300. This would trigger a health alert signifying that everyone may experience more serious health effects. "Hazardous" AQI greater than 300. This would trigger a health warnings of emergency conditions.
